Passage frequency

fBPF = Z × n / 60 = Z × fs [Hz]
fs = n / 60 [Hz]

Z is the integer number of recurring rotor elements, n is shaft speed in r/min, and fs is shaft rotational frequency. For a fixed observation point, Z equally recurring elements produce Z passages per revolution. ANSI/AMCA 301-22 gives this same fan blade-pass equation in its sound-rating method (Eq. 5.7).

Harmonikos ir šoninės juostos

The table lists mathematical integer harmonics h·fBPF. Real spectra may contain BPF, harmonics and modulation components, but their presence and amplitude depend on rotor/stator geometry, flow, loading, sensor location, structure and acoustic response. A calculated line is a frequency marker, not a predicted spectral amplitude.

Diagnostic boundary

Do not diagnose from one line. A BPF peak, its harmonics or shaft-spaced sidebands do not uniquely prove clearance error, blade damage, fouling, resonance, recirculation or cavitation. Compare like-for-like operating points with baseline/trend data and use corroborating phase, waveform, pressure, acoustic, process and inspection evidence. Cavitation assessment also requires hydraulic operating and NPSH evidence.

Worked calculation

Six vanes at 2950 r/min

fs = 2950/60 = 49.1667 Hz

fBPF = 6 × 49.1667 = 295 Hz

Laikotarpis = 1/295 = 3.3898 ms; 2×BPF = 590 Hz; 3×BPF = 885 Hz.

Sources and standard scope

Taikymo sritis: steady shaft speed and one integer count of equally recurring elements. Variable speed smears or sweeps the frequency; nonuniform pitch can create additional components. This calculator is not an ISO severity or acceptance assessment.
